While GPS will get you close, the real journey involves knowing which coastal road to take and how the local landscape frames the turquoise water. Highway Primary Destinations Key Region A1 (Northern Coastal Highway) Montego Bay, Negril West/North West A3 Port Antonio, Buff Bay North East A4 Kingston, Bluefields, Black River South East Navigating the Final Leg to the Sand Once you exit the main highway, the roads can narrow and wind.

Finding your way to a Jamaican beach requires a blend of modern navigation and an understanding of the island’s unique geography. The south coast, while stunning, is more rugged and less populated, requiring a greater reliance on local knowledge.

Understanding which highway aligns with your beach destination is the first critical step in eliminating wrong turns. Often, the correct path is the one showing the most wear and tear, branching off toward the sound of waves rather than following the GPS blindly into a sugarcane field.
